web analytics
useage of automation testing service

Automation in software testing has become increasingly popular because of its convenience, accuracy, and other benefits. It ensures that the cost of software development is minimized, ensuring high-quality services and seamless user experience.

Automation testing is highly benefitting the software quality and user experience & is delivering success in a short span. Businesses that require quick testing without investing much in manual tasks and increasing the downtime of the project must invest in automation testing services.

In this blog, we’ll discuss in detail how automation testing services can improve software quality & user experience. 

software testing

Benefits of Automation Testing Services for Software Quality

The quality of software depends upon several factors and can be impacted by even small things. But with automation testing services, one can improve the quality by detecting faults & errors, increasing the product’s functionality & performance. The
following are some of the benefits of automation testing services for software quality:

  1. Detecting defects: Developers can detect & identify the defects and errors before the final launch of the product using automation software services. This helps them to make necessary changes on time. It ultimately reduces the cost of fixing them later & ensures that software applications are reliable and error-free.
  2. Improving test coverage: Manual testing will never go out of the game, but one cannot only rely completely on manual testing. Automation testing helps to ease manual testing by improving the test coverage, which helps to identify defects that may not be found through manual testing.
  3. Reducing testing time: Testing the software manually can take up a considerable amount of time & effort and leads to extended project delivery time. With automated testing, the software can be tested accurately without investing human effort & ultimately helping to deliver the project on time.
  4. Automate repetitive tasks. Automation testing services can be used to automate repetitive tasks that can consume more time and effort. These tasks include data entry & test execution, which are error-prone if done manually, allowing testers to focus more on core tasks.
 

Benefits of Automation Testing Services for User Experience

User experience is the core area that needs the attention and focus of developers and testers. If the final product has a bad user experience in terms of design and structure, the end users will no longer prefer to use it.
 

With automation testing services, the overall UI/UX of the product can be improved before its final launch. The benefits of automation testing services for user experience are given below:

  1. Consistency & responsiveness: Automation testing helps to ensure that the product will be user-friendly on all the platforms and users will not find any usage difficult.
  2. Identifying usability issues: Implementing automation testing can help the tester/developer identify usability issues during the development process, making it precise & user-friendly.
  3. Enhanced accessibility: A user-friendly & feature-rich application/product is well appreciated by users. And with automated testing, one can make the software more engaging & useful during the development phase.
 

How to Implement Automation Testing Services?

When it comes to automation testing implementation, it is essential to go carefully with its process. Here are the best practices for implementing automation testing services with your development system:

Plan testing strategy. Before starting with automation testing, you need to plan everything in advance. This involves determining the objectives of testing, creating your test scenarios & test cases, and, most importantly, selecting the automation tools that best meet your needs.

Create & analyze effective test cases. Analyze & examine the test cases to ensure that they are precise, understandable, and thorough. This helps the developers to plot errors and defects during the software life cycle and ultimately reduces the testing expenses.

Integrate automation testing with your development process. Automation testing should be a part of your development process to be certain that you consistently examine your software at each stage. This will reduce harmful mistakes made later in the project. Using these practices, one can efficiently utilize the benefits of automation software testing.

The Bottom Line

Automation testing services have made the testing process much earlier & accurate for developers. Implementing a successful automated testing strategy will help the product become more competitive and user-friendly.

If you are looking for the best software testing services that will make your investment worthwhile, make sure to reach QAcraft. We are a team of expert testers and developers that understand the importance of bug-free and user-friendly products; thus, we strive to provide better, unbeatable testing services. 

Get in touch with our experts & let us make your product more visually appealing.

Related Post